Can a dental hygienist afford rent in Le Claire, IA?
Median rent in Le Claire is $2,900 a month. A typical dental hygienist in Iowa earns about $80,509 a year, which makes that rent 43.2% of gross monthly income. Under the 30% rule, the answer is no — rent exceeds the 30% threshold.
How much rent can a dental hygienist afford in Le Claire?
Using the 30% rule, a dental hygienist salary in Iowa (~$80,509/yr) supports up to $2,013 a month in rent. Le Claire's current median rent is $2,900/mo, which is $887/mo over the affordability threshold.
How many hours does a dental hygienist work to cover rent in Le Claire?
At an hourly equivalent of about $39 an hour, a dental hygienist in Iowa works roughly 74.9 hours a month to cover Le Claire's median rent of $2,900.
